Dalloyau is a famous caterer located on the Faubourg-Saint-Honoré and whose origin dates back to 1682 at the court of the Château de Versailles. Dalloyau operates as a pastry chef, chocolate maker and caterer in two distribution channels, boutiques and events and receptions. In 2018 the company is experiencing some difficulties and has implemented a restructuring planclosing two Parisian stores and laying off about 20 people.
Dalloyau has a dozen stores in Île de France, one in Marseille and exports to Japan. Specialized in pastry, the company also offers a reception organizer service.
They offer the following delicatessen products: caviar, foie gras, salmon, pastries, chocolates and macaroons.
